Back To School In The Mt. Diablo District: It's That Time Again

Mt. Diablo schools reopen this week as families navigate new schedules, meetings, and back-to-school preparations across campuses.

CONCORD, CA — Mt. Diablo Unified students have already returned to classrooms, putting Concord families among the earliest in the region to start the 2026-27 school year.

The first day was Aug. 6, according to the district's current calendar.

Next, the Board of Education meets Wednesday from 6 to 9:30 p.m., giving parents their first board meeting after students returned.

Another board meeting follows Aug. 26, also from 6 to 9:30 p.m. The district encourages residents to attend and participate in educational affairs.

Parents also have campus-specific Back-to-School Nights approaching.

Highlands Elementary scheduled its TK/K Back-to-School Night for Thursday, Aug. 13. Bancroft Elementary plans a Grades 1-5 Back-to-School Night Aug. 19, while Highlands has another event for Grades 1-5 and MAPS Aug. 25.

The district's Community Advisory Committee also meets Aug. 18 from 7 to 9 p.m.

Concord-Area Dates Parents Should Know

Wednesday, Aug. 12: Board of Education meeting, 6-9:30 p.m.

Thursday, Aug. 13: Highlands Elementary TK/K Back-to-School Night, 6-6:45 p.m.

Tuesday, Aug. 18: Community Advisory Committee meeting, 7-9 p.m.

Wednesday, Aug. 19: Bancroft Elementary Grades 1-5 Back-to-School Night, 6-7 p.m.

Tuesday, Aug. 25: Highlands Elementary Grades 1-5 and MAPS Back-to-School Night, 6-7 p.m.

Wednesday, Aug. 26: Board of Education meeting, 6-9:30 p.m.

Monday, Sept. 7: Labor Day.
